Transaction 15039de5c11c5684014fd25f710e4616a06e94c913fa525b6927d116089055c2
1 Input
1 Output
-
15039de5c11c5684014fd25f710e4616a06e94c913fa525b6927d116089055c2:0
- value
- 806508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b294dcbf27ed0a5a76cada264b4f48a7d819b489 OP_EQUAL
- address
- 3HyGXpgbJgkTQBr6nR3jAZZzXDdTXPnzow